Transaction 445156cd2546204686d48f62fcdb0c9e1e72120579085d7133eb9e04e7145bda
1 Input
2 Outputs
- 445156cd2546204686d48f62fcdb0c9e1e72120579085d7133eb9e04e7145bda:0
- 445156cd2546204686d48f62fcdb0c9e1e72120579085d7133eb9e04e7145bda:1
value 3139000
address 3CvJJ1r2UmXi4BZFTNTGr5x96V3u1TyBtd
value 629636746
address 1sR8VXZ8kBvtwnHQjevxJ6D5amvVHtDw2